Recent July 2026 CPI data, showing headline inflation easing to 3.4% year-over-year and core at 2.5%, alongside the Fed's July decision to hold the federal funds rate at 3.50-3.75%, has reinforced trader expectations for a hawkish pause. Elevated shelter costs and lingering effects from prior energy pressures continue to influence the inflation trajectory, while the June dot plot and subsequent communications indicate a median projection leaning toward steady or higher rates by year-end rather than cuts. Fed funds futures currently price in limited easing probability through the September 15-16 FOMC meeting, with labor market resilience providing additional support for the current policy stance. Market-implied odds reflect aggregated trader consensus on these dynamics, though upcoming September data releases could shift sentiment if inflation moderates further.
